New England’s Finest: Coasts, History, and America’s Most Spectacular Fall Colors
New England peaks in the fall. For a magical few weeks from late September to mid-October, the region transforms as maples, oaks, and birches shift from green to blazing red, orange, and gold. Photographers from around the world come to capture the spectacular colors. But pictures never tell the whole story.
Newport, Rhode Island, is a cornerstone of all things refined. The Gilded Age mansions along Bellevue Avenue are audacious displays of wealth in American architectural history. Private estate tours and boat charters provide a glimpse into what old money can buy, and the best luxury hotels in New England are right there to match the experience.
Boston delivers the culture. There’s fine dining, world-class museums, and a historic core perfect for those who love walking and aren’t in a hurry. For an arts-and-wilderness alternative, you can visit Tanglewood and MASS MoCA in the Berkshires in western Massachusetts. There, the mountainous landscapes reach peak color a little earlier than the coast.
Maine closes the itinerary. Acadia National Park, the rocky coastline around Bar Harbor, and the freshest seafood in the country make it an essential final chapter on a trip worth writing home about.
